Man Drunk-Dialing 911 Looking For Free Ride—Gets One To Jail In Maryland: Sheriff A Maryland man who treated 911 like a personal Uber service found himself riding straight to jail instead, authorities said. Maurice Franklin Jacks, 62, of Huntingtown, was arrested after repeatedly calling Calvert County emergency dispatchers asking for a ride—and then hanging up each time, according to the Calvert County Sheriff's Office. Giant Grocery Store Brings Over 200 Jobs To Anne Arundel County A Giant grocery store is bringing over 200 jobs to Anne Arundel County with the opening of their brand new store at Crofton Center, reports Fox 45.  Doors opened to the store on Friday, Jan. 20. The brand new store features upgraded amenities for customers to better serve as a one stop shop, the outlet continues.  The full-service location offers not only groceries, but vaccine administrations including COVID-19 vaccines and boosters. The store serves as a replacement for the Giant store on MD Route 3 in Gambrills. To read the full story by Fox 45, click here.
